The climate of Raufarhöfn (Iceland)
Raufarhöfn is a small fishing village located in the northeastern part
of Iceland at less than 10 kilometers from the Arctic Circle.
Raufarhöfn is the most northerly located village of Iceland. Because
of its situation in the vicinity of the Melrakkasletta plains the
village is very popular with the more adventurous tourist. A small
hotel can be found in the village. From Raufarhöfn you can take a
whale spotting trip by boat; if you are in luck you might spot some
whales. Because of its northerly location Raufarhöfn has a tundra
climate. This means that during the warmest month temperatures will
not exceed 10 degrees Celsius. During the coldest month it will always
be colder than -3 degrees Celsius. However, because the warm Gulf
Stream passes by Raufarhöfn the village only just meets these
criteria. Annual temperatures are 2 degrees Celsius on average.
Raufarhöfn only gets 72 millimeters of annual precipitation.
